Administrative Specialist Finance
Waubonsee Community College is dedicated to making a positive impact in the community and the lives of students. They are seeking an Administrative Specialist in Finance to provide comprehensive administrative support to the Finance department, including vendor maintenance, financial reporting, and office transactions.

Responsibilities
Serve as administrative specialist to the Assistant Vice President of Finance, the Director of Financial and Auxiliary Services, and Finance department
Maintain and verify vendor records with processes including but not limited to new vendor creation, vendor application and updates, and document verification
Assist with preparation and filing of financial reporting, including but not limited to college audit, tax levy, and college budget
Anticipate, coordinate, and process routine office transactions (i.e., travel arrangements, expense reports, creating/updating forms/templates, requisitions, monitor and order office supplies, mail distribution, etc.)
Maintain and monitor all records pertaining to the responsibilities of the Finance department; Assist with records management for the college
Process retirees medical billing and assist with annual data collection for valuation
Maintain calendars for the Finance administrators
Coordinate meetings, including communications, room scheduling, room set-ups, and record minutes
Record and monitor time and attendance for the Finance department
Assist with processing transactions related to accounts receivable, accounts payable, and purchasing
Perform other duties as assigned
Qualification
Required
High school diploma or equivalent
Three Years Related Administrative Experience
Aptitude for numbers and attention to detail
Experience with Windows, Microsoft Word, Excel, electronic calendar and mail
Ability to work independently with demonstrated ability to manage multiple competing tasks within the established deadlines
Excellent written and oral communication, organizational and human relations skills with the ability to handle sensitive issues, maintain confidentiality and communicate professionally
Proficiency in editing, proofreading, and protecting sensitive information
Preferred
Associate degree or additional financial accounting, administrative training and/or coursework
Experience with accounting software systems
